      Yeah, there're usually embedded compensations the body's set into place that will limit movement of the pelvis. A lot of it boils down to important postural muscles being weak and shortened over a long period of time most likely from sitting. A key muscle to look at is the psoas and the leg muscles (usually lengthened & weak hamstrings and tight quads). And don't forget mobility i.e doing or trying to do the movement you want to achieve so do the posterior pelvis tilt or try to often. Gd luck
